In 2019-2020, 114 people earned their degree in brass instruments, making the major the 984th most popular in the United States.

Across the New England region, there were 22 brass instruments graduates with average earnings and debt of $0 and $0 respectively. At the master’s degree level specifically, there were 12 brass instruments graduates with average earnings and debt of $58,606 and $42,101 respectively.

Longy School of Music of Bard College

Cambridge, Massachusetts
#1 in overall quality

You’ll join some of the best and brightest minds around if you attend Longy School of Music of Bard College. The school came in at #1 for the Best Value Brass Instruments Schools for a Master’s in the New England Region. Longy School of Music of Bard College is a small school located in Cambridge, Massachusetts that handed out 1 masters’s brass instruments degrees in 2019-2020.

Longy also took the #1 spot in our “Best Brass Instruments Master’s Degree Schools in the New England Region” ranking. Average graduate tuition and fees at Longy School of Music of Bard College are $46,880, but some majors have different tuition rates.
